Dataset Overview
Project: Satellite proxy for the AMOC at 26N
Description: A dynamically based method for estimating the Atlantic meridional overturning circulation at 26°N from satellite altimetry
Source File: altimetry_moc_transport_1993_2020_18mos_smoothed.nc
Data Product: A dynamically based method for estimating the Atlantic meridional overturning circulation at 26°N from satellite altimetry
License: CC-BY-4.0
Time Coverage: 1993-01-17 to 2018-12-17
Record Length: 312 observations (25.9 years)
Sampling Frequency: monthly
Citation:
Sanchez-Franks, A., Frajka-Williams, E., Moat, B. I., and Smeed, D. A.: A dynamically based method for estimating the Atlantic meridional overturning circulation at 26°N from satellite altimetry, Ocean Sci., 17, 1321-1340, https://doi.org/10.5194/os-17-1321-2021, 2021

Variable Information
The following table shows the mapping from original variable names to standardized names, along with key statistics for each variable.
Variable |
Description |
Units |
Size |
Min Value |
Max Value |
Missing % |
|---|---|---|---|---|---|---|
sat_moc_filt → MOC_PROXY |
MOC proxy: constructed by adding the satellite-derived TRANS_GS and TRANS_UMO with the TRANS_EK, obtained from ERA5 wind stress |
sverdrup |
(312,) |
-3.76 |
2.83 |
0.0% |
sat_gs_filt → TRANS_GS_PROXY |
Gulf Stream / Florida Current: The strength of the Gulf Stream transport through the Florida Straits between Florida and Bahamas, as measured by a submarine telephone cable. |
sverdrup |
(312,) |
-0.64 |
1.09 |
0.0% |
sat_umo_filt → TRANS_UMO_PROXY |
UMO proxy: sum of the western boundary wedge transport, the hypsometric mass compensation, and the internal geostrophic transport over the top 1100 m |
sverdrup |
(312,) |
-2.37 |
3.20 |
0.0% |
